He found that if he could fix the muscles, the patient would have better results. As in the case of neurolymphatic reflexes, Goodheart concluded that specific muscles were related to specific organs.

For example, weak abdominal muscles will cause the pelvis to tilt and the low back muscles (which oppose them) to go into spasm. Edited by: Rothstein JM. Until the weakness in the abdominal muscles is corrected, efforts to reduce the spasm in the low back will not be very effective.
